India, Nov. 3 -- Four people, including two brothers, were killed and five others injured after a Bolero SUV collided head-on with a Uttar Pradesh Roadways bus near the Khok petrol pump on the Karwi-Prayagraj highway late on Sunday night.
The Bolero was coming from Khok village towards Karwi when it crashed into the state transport bus heading to Prayagraj. The impact left the SUV's front completely mangled.
The victims, all from Champa ka purwa in the Sitapur police outpost area, were identified as Raja Bhaiya, 40, his wife Shobha, 35, their children Mohit, 14, Subhash, 7, and Sandhya, 14, along with relatives Rohit and Arjun and three others.
